import pandas as pd
from models.base import Model
# | Reporting
# |
class Single_Model:
def __init__(self, model_name:str, model_over_time:list[Model]):
self.model_name: str = model_name
self.model_over_time: list[Model] = model_over_time
class Training_Step:
def __init__(self, level:str):
self.level:str = level
self.base: list[Single_Model] = []
self.metalabeling: list[list[Single_Model]] = []
class Asset():
def __init__(self, ticker:str, primary: Training_Step, secondary: Training_Step):
self.name:str = ticker
self.primary:Training_Step = primary
self.secondary:Training_Step = secondary
class Reporting:
def __init__(self):
self.results:pd.DataFrame = pd.DataFrame()
self.all_predictions:pd.DataFrame = pd.DataFrame()
self.all_probabilities:pd.DataFrame = pd.DataFrame()
self.all_assets:list[Asset] = []
def get_results(self)->tuple[pd.DataFrame, pd.DataFrame, pd.DataFrame, list[Asset]]:
return self.results, self.all_predictions, self.all_probabilities, self.all_assets
